I had this problem, couldn't fix using the tool, couldn't fix "manually" via associations. However, I was able to make Iron (Portable) my default browser on two computers both running windows 7 by making IE the default then making Iron the default. It's probably not the "cleanest" (because you'll leave some IE defaults in place), but all links work and stuff opens Iron automatically -- so it's at least a good starting point.

1)Make Internet Explorer the default browser using the Default Programs control panel
-- Start Menu
-- Click Default Programs
-- Click "Set your default programs"
-- Click on the Internet Explorer icon
-- Click "Set this program as the default"
-- Close the window

2) Make Iron the default browser inside Iron itself
-- Open Iron directly from the .exe
-- If it asks with a banner "Iron isn't the default browser...", Click "Set as the default" or "OK"
-- If it doesn't ask, set it as the default using the settings.
